To check your Autostacker alignment prior to anchoring:
1. Using the drawing as a guide, measure A and B to make sure your Leg Assemblies are parallel. If
the values are different, adjust as necessary.
2. Measure 1 and 2 to check your diagonal measurements. If the values are different, adjust as
necessary.
3. When you believe your Leg Assemblies are parallel and the diagonals are correct,
check your
measurements again!
Important: Poor alignment can affect how your Autostacker raises and lowers. Re-aligning the
Leg Assemblies
after
you anchor them into place is difficult. It is well worth your time
to align your Autostacker correctly before you anchor it into place.
Concrete specifications are:
• Depth: 4.25 inches
• PSI: 3,000 PSI, minimum
• Cured: 28 days, minimum
Anchor Bolt specifications are:
• Length: 4.75 inches
• Diameter: .75 inch
• Anchor torque: 85 – 95 pound feet
